The 2006 Morocco third jersey stands as a striking piece of North African football heritage, capturing an era of transition and flair for the Atlas Lions. Produced by Puma, this rare kit features a bold, unconventional colorway that departed from the traditional red and green, reflecting Morocco's ambition on the international stage. The design is characterized by Puma’s iconic 2006-era template, which emphasized sleek lines and breathable performance fabrics that defined mid-2000s football aesthetics. While the team navigated a challenging period during the 2006 Africa Cup of Nations, this shirt remains a highly sought-after collector's item for its rarity and unique visual identity. It represents the pride of Moroccan supporters and the artistry of a generation of players who brought technical brilliance to the pitch.
